Maryville University of Saint Louis accepted 95.1% of applicants, making it Open Admission.
| Test | 25th Percentile | Midpoint | 75th Percentile |
|---|---|---|---|
| SAT Total | — | 1115 | — |
| SAT Reading | — | 560 | — |
| SAT Math | — | 555 | — |
| ACT Composite | — | 23 | — |
Tuition at Maryville University of Saint Louis is $27,166. After financial aid, the average net price is $22,066. About 36.4% of students receive Pell Grants.
| Cost Category | Amount |
|---|---|
| Tuition & Fees | $27,166 |
| Room & Board (On Campus) | $13,900 |
| Total Cost of Attendance | $41,959 |
| Average Net Price (After Aid) | $22,066 |
| Students Receiving Pell Grants | 36.4% |
| Students Taking Federal Loans | 52.7% |
Graduates of Maryville University of Saint Louis earn a median salary of $62,105 ten years after enrollment. The graduation rate is 68.7%. Median student debt at graduation is $22,000, with an estimated monthly loan payment of $233.

| Outcome Metric | Value |
|---|---|
| Median Earnings (6 Years After) | $55,047/yr |
| Median Earnings (8 Years After) | $59,194/yr |
| Median Earnings (10 Years After) | $62,105/yr |
| Graduation Rate (4-Year) | 68.7% |
| Freshman Retention Rate | 84.7% |
| Median Student Debt | $22,000 |
| Est. Monthly Loan Payment (10yr) | $233/mo |
| 3-Year Repayment Rate | 57.3% |
Maryville University of Saint Louis has 5,658 undergraduate students. The student body is 69.4% female. About 29.6% are first-generation college students. The average age at entry is 24.0.
| Student Metric | Value |
|---|---|
| Total Undergraduates | 5,658 |
| Female Students | 69.4% |
| First-Generation Students | 29.6% |
| Average Age at Entry | 24.0 |
| Students Over 25 | 37.1% |
